1704 cover image1933 Balbo Shediac - Chicago Flight (July 14): Autographed Balbo envelope, endorsed 'VIA ITALIAN CRUISE OF GENERAL BALBO / TO CHICAGO", franked with CAD $1.45 and tied by "SHEDIAC JUL 23 33" duplex to Chicago with arrival of July 15, returned by ordinary mail to "GRIMSBY JUL 17 33 ONT". On July 14th the flight formation took off from Shediac to complete the last two legs (750 km, Shediac - Montreal and 1,550 km, Montreal - Chicago) of the route up to Chicago. This signed cover is one of the 289 covers dispatched from Shediac. Most of the covers were franked with $1.45 which is considered as being the correct rate (Ref: AAMC and Longhi) Longhi 2937 = Euro 1'000. (Image 1) (Image 2) (Image 3)

3099 cover imageIncoming Mail Overland via Southampton 1864 (Nov 7): Cover from Prince Edward Island to Bendigo, Victoria bearing 1863 Prince Edward Island 6 d. yellow- green and 9 d. lilac, three examples, one with fault and piece of stamp replaced at base, each cancelled by barred numeral “13” and prepaying 2 s. 9 d. for a 1⁄2 ounce ship letter to Victoria. Manuscript “1/8” (sterling) in red credit to Great Britain for forwarding to Victoria. On delivery (Feb 12) to Bendigo (Sandhurst), the addressee was unable to be found and struck with “UNKNOWN BY / LETTER CARRIER" handstamp in black together with the oval “UNCLAIMED” in blue. It stayed at the Bendigo Post Office until the Sept 2, when it appears that the letter was delivered. Some minor soiling, however, very rare. Cert. Vincent Graves Greene (2010). Route - Private steamship: Departed Prince Edward Island 7 Nov 1864 by private steamship to Quebec. Inman Line: Departed Quebec (11 Nov) per “Damascus” to Liverpool (21 Nov); by rail via to Southampton. P&O Line: Departed Southampton (20 Dec) per “Ceylon” via Malta (29 Dec) to Alexandria 2 Jan 1865; overland to Suez; “Nemesis” (5 Jan) to Galle (21 Jan); “Northam” (22 Jan) via King Georges Sound (5 Feb) to Melbourne (11 Feb), by rail to Bendigo, arriving 12 Feb 1865 (97 days). Note: The only cover recorded from Prince Edward Island to the Australian Colonies. By way of comparison, there is only one cover recorded from the Australian Colonies (Victoria) to Prince Edward Island (Lot 3156). (Image 1) (Image 2) (Image 3) (Image 4)

3430 cover/bof imageIncoming Mail via Pacific Ocean 1887 (Nov 25): Cover from Montreal, Canada to Sydney and redirected to Suez, Egypt bearing 1873 Canada 3 c. orange-red, a single and block of four, perf. faults at top, clearly cancelled by the Montreal duplex and prepaying 15 c. for a 1⁄2 ounce ship letter to New South Wales. On arrival, the addressee, the Canadian physician Rankine Dawson, a passenger aboard the P&O Line steamer “Massilia” which had already sailed, was kept at Sydney and the cover redirected to Suez, Egypt. The cover is endorsed “Via San Francisco” at upper left with multiple transit datestamps on the reverse. A small piece of the reverse of the cover cut out, otherwise fine. A very scarce destination from Canada, particularly with the redirection to Egypt. Route: Departed Montreal, Canada 25 Nov 1887 by rail via Windsor (25 Nov) to San Francisco. Union Steamship Co. of New Zealand: Departed San Francisco (7 Dec) per “Republic” via Auckland (6 Jan 1888) to Sydney, arriving 11 Jan 1888, redirected to Suez (over 47 days). (Image 1) (Image 2)

2332 cover imageMail to and from Neutral Countries: Cape Verde 1941 (Aug. 26): Registered LATI seagull envelope from Espargos on Sal Island addressed to the 'FIUME' Insurance Co. (aeronautical office) in Rome, franked with 16,35 Escudos and carried by SM82 I-SENI, departing Brazil Aug.23, 1941. Rare envelope in very well condition. There is no receiving datestamp although the letter is registered, so it is most likely the letter was prepared by an Italian member of the LATI base there. Lati was the only airline flying through Cape Verde Islands at the time. (Image 1) (Image 2)

2333 cover imageMail to and from Neutral Countries: Cape Verde 1940 (Feb. 19): Registered envelope endorsed 'até Lisboa' sent from S.Vicente Colonia de Cabo Verde to Brussels, franked with 14.55 Escudos (incl. New York Exhibition ovpted. 5 E.), flown by LATI feeder service to Portugal with "Lisboa Central 25. Fev. 40" on reverse, thence to Paris via Air France and onward by rail to Brussels as Belgium was not occupied until May 1940. A fine and rare LATI acceptance to Belgium. (Image 1) (Image 2)

2336 cover imageMail to and from Neutral Countries: Cape Verde 1941 (Aug 14): Censored envelope to New York endorsed 'Via Lati, Isla do Sal' in red, franked with 9.55 Escudos. Cover taken from Mindelo by boat to Sal Island with transit cds (Aug. 17th) on reverse for LATI transmission to Seville and feeder service to Lisbon (Aug. 24th), forwarded by Panam Clipper service with British censor tape applied in Bermuda. Only few LATI covers from Cape Verde Islands with British Bermuda censor recorded. (Image 1) (Image 2)
